- 1、本文档共2页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
单片机与可编程器件
基于单片机的
多功能数字钟系统设计
·山东交通学院信息工程系 张吉卫 王晓红·
摘要:设计了一款能够显示时间信息、环境温度、电网电压、电网频率的多功能数字钟。并介绍了系统组成以及硬件电路和
软件设计。
目前市售的电子钟品种较多,一般 压欠压报警信号,分别驱动外部声光报 机P3.0、P3.1、P3.2控制,其中P3.2作数
只能显示时间信息,功能单一。在电子钟 警电路;P3口主要是第二功能的应用。 据封锁信号,P3.0为数据输入,P3.1为时
基础上有必要开发一种适用于特殊行业 因此,单片机系统资源已得到充分利 钟信号。
如电力部门使用的多功能数字钟。笔者 用。系统主电路如图2所示。 (2)显示电路 多功能数字钟需要显
采用几种新型芯片,利用单片机技术,设 示信息较多,如年、月、日、时、分、秒、
计了一种具有基本的电子时钟、闹钟功 闹钟设定时间等时间信息以及温度、电
能,并能显示环境温度、电网电压、电网 源电压、频率等值。为充分明确显示数
频率及实现过压欠压报警的多功能数字 据,采用OCMJ 4×8中文液晶显示模块,
钟。系统充分挖掘了单片机的资源和运 该模块内含GB2312 16*16点阵国标一级
算控制能力,具有功能多、显示全、成本 简体汉字和ASCⅡ码,可实现文本显示。
低的特点。 OCMJ 4×8中文模块不需初始化,设置
图1
初始化的工作都在上电时自动完成,实
系统结构
1.键盘显示 现了 “即插即用”。其用户硬件接口采用
多功能数字钟组成框图如图1所示。
(1)键盘电路 多功能数字钟按键主 REQ/BUSY握手协议,简单可靠。BUSY
主要包括时钟模块,键盘显示模块,温
要有设置、增、减、闹铃开关键,以实现 高电平有效,表示OCMJ忙,不能接受命
度、电压、频率测量模块,电源模块等。
时间调整、设置等功能。为节省口线,采 令;BUSY=0时,表示OCMJ空闲。同时
单片机分时进行时间、温度、电压、频率
用并行输入、串行输出移位寄存器 REQ=1时通知OCMJ处理当前数据线上
等信号的测量和读取。
74LS165扩展接口,一片74LS165最多可 的数据。我们选P2口的P2.6和P2.7作为
利用汉字液晶显示器显示相关信息,
实现8个按键输入。键盘数据读入由单片 其联络口。
并通过键盘方便地校对时钟、
设定闹铃时间和过欠压报警
值。利用不同声光信息实现闹
铃和报警。
硬件电路
多功能数字钟系统采用
AT89C52作为中央处理芯片,
用于数据处理、初值设定、显
示控制等。单片机P0口用于
时钟芯片时间信息读取;P1
口用于液晶显示器显示数据
的传送;P2口用作控制信号
和握手联络信号,其中P2.3
输出闹铃信号,P2.4输出过 图2
·29 ·电子世界2005年4期
单片机与可编程器件
文档评论(0)